115學年度第1學期「學生學習社群募課」開始申請!讓興趣變成通識學分

各位同學們,115學年度第1學期「學生學習社群募課」開始申請!把你的興趣變成通識學分吧!只要找夥伴針對有興趣的主題進行研討,完成執行後經審查通過,就能順利抵換通識教育中心興趣自選2學分,還有機會抱走期末競賽獎金!(註:學生於在學期間內,社群募課學分採認以2學分為限;線上填報至115/09/21、紙本收件至115/09/22止)。

宣傳影片:https://youtu.be/67aTvh1VOHo

申請指南
只要是本校在學學生,找
3至8人(可跨院系、學制與年級)邀請1位本校專任或兼任教師 擔任指導老師即可開團!每位同學最多參與2組。團員需注意,每組至少要有1位代表參加「期初說明會」與「期末成果發表會」,否則會被取消資格與經費補助喔
申請日程
1.線上報名:即日起至115/09/21(一)中午12:00止,由召集人填寫線上申請表(https://reurl.cc/OQvdQg)  。
2.紙本送件:收到系統電子郵件後,將申請表雙面列印,跑完「召集人 → 指導教師 → 召集人學系主任 → 學院院長」簽核,於115/09/22(二)17:00前送至L棟1樓教學發展中心。
3.重要時程:115/09/23~09/30審查、預計
115/10/01公告結果;執行期為10/01至12/15;期末成果競賽日:預計115/12/24(四)。


社群要做什麼?
1.執行期間須在校內完成至少36小時的聚會或活動(講座與討論分享、實作與操作演練、參訪與實地走訪、展覽與推廣活動等)。
2.115/12/18(五)中午12:00前繳交成果資料
(1)紙本(送至L棟1樓
教學發展中心):經指導教師簽章之36小時紀錄與簽到表、成果報告、期末自評表。
(2)電子檔(寄至cdt@g2.usc.edu.tw):成果報告、A1海報檔(84.1
cm x59.4cm / 100dpi)、10頁內期末競賽簡報。

補助與競賽獎金
1.獲核定社群除可申請學生獎勵金外,
指導教師可獲2,000元指導費。預計於115/12/24(四)舉辦期末競賽,3名可分別獲得5,000元、4,000元、3,000元獎金,佳作2組各2,000元!(*補助金額將依據學期預算另訂,僅提供114-2學期之核定金額參考。)
2.審查通過並順利執行完畢者,經本校自主學習課程審議小組審議通過後,於次一學期採認通識教育中心興趣自選2學分。(註:學生於在學期間內,社群募課學分採認以2學分為限)

Applications for "Student Learning Community Course Crowdfunding" for Fall Semester 2026 are now open! Turn your interests into General Education credits! 

(Online submission open until Sept 21, 2026; Hardcopy submission open until Sept 22, 2026)

Dear students, applications for Fall Semester 2026 "Student Learning Community Course Crowdfunding" have officially begun! Turn your passion into academic credits! As long as you find partners to explore a topic of interest, pass the review, and complete the project, you can successfully earn 2 elective credits in General Education, plus a chance to win cash prizes in the final competition! (Note: A maximum of 2 credits can be recognized from student learning communities during your study period)


Application Guidelines
Any currently enrolled student can form a team of 3 to 8 members (cross-Department, cross-system, and cross-grade levels are allowed) and invite 1 full-time or part-time Teacher from our university to serve as the advisor! Each student can join up to 2 groups. Please note: at least 1 representative from each group must attend both the "Orientation" and the "Final Presentation", or your qualification and funding will be canceled!

Application Schedule
1.Online Application: From now until Monday,
 Sept 21, 2026, 12:00 PM. The convener must complete the online application form (https://reurl.cc/OQvdQg).
2.Hardcopy Submission: After receiving the system email, print the application form double-sided, obtain approval signatures following the path "Convener → Advisory Teacher → Convener's Department Chair → College Dean", and submit it to the Center for Teaching and Learning Development on Building L, 1st Floor before Tuesday,
 Sept 22, 2026, 17:00.
3.Key Timeline: Review period Sept 23–30, 2026; Results announcement expected on Oct 1, 2026; Execution period Oct 1 to Dec 15, 2026; Final Results Competition Date expected on
 Dec 24, 2026 (Thu) .

Community Requirements
1.Complete at least 36 hours of on-campus meetings/activities during the execution period (e.g., lectures, group discussions, practical workshops, field visits, exhibitions).
2.Submit final deliverables by 
Dec 18, 2026 (Fri) 12:00 PM:
(1)Hard copy (Submit to Building L, 1st Floor, Center for Teaching and Learning Development): 36-hour activity record and sign-in sheet endorsed by the advisory Teacher, final report, and final self-evaluation form.
(2)Electronic Files (Email to cdt@g2.usc.edu.tw): Final report, A1 poster file (84.1cm x 59.4cm / 100dpi), and final competition slides (max 10 pages).


Grants and Competition Prizes
1. Approved communities can apply for student incentives, and the advising Teacher receives a guidance stipend of NT$2,000. The final competition is scheduled for Dec 24, 2026 (Thu). The top 3 teams receive NT$5,000, NT$4,000, and NT$3,000 respectively, with 2 merit awards receiving NT$2,000 each! (*Grant amounts subject to semester budget adjustments; Spring Semester 2026 amounts provided for reference.)
2.Those who pass review and successfully complete execution, upon approval by the Self-Directed Learning Committee, will be granted 2 elective General Education credits in the following semester. (Note: Credit limit capped at 2 credits per student during enrolment).
